After playing college basketball for the LSU Tigers, O’Neal was selected by the Orlando Magic with the first overall pick in the 1992 NBA draft. He quickly became one of the best centers in the league, winning NBA Rookie of the Year in 1992–93 and leading his team to the 1995 NBA Finals. After four years with the Magic, O’Neal signed as a free agent with the Los Angeles Lakers. They won three consecutive championships in 2000, 2001, and 2002. Amid a feud between O’Neal and his teammate Kobe Bryant, O’Neal was traded to the Miami Heat in 2004.

The Shaq Attaq 4, also known as the Instapump Shaq Attaq, was originally released during the 1994-1995 NBA season. Shaquille O’Neal wore these shoes during that season, which included appearances in the All-Star Game and the NBA Finals.
